The Infinite Jeff - A Parable of Change by Will Holcomb

Sometimes the wrong place is the right place.

Against his better judgment, Stanley picks up the mysterious hitchhiker and starts down a path he isn't prepared to take.

This hitchhiker is like no person Stanley has ever met or even heard about and has answers no one has even been able to answer.

Will Holcomb is a software engineer, as well as a writer and dramatist. The Infinite Jeff, a four-part book, tackles issues that affect both individuals and society/humanity. It examines religion and human potential in a intriguing way. Shakespeare Rocks, his debut play, was written for a young group as a fun approach to pique their interest in Shakespeare. Clinically Un-Depressed, his second play, premiered to sold-out audiences and standing ovations.

It was the highest-grossing show of the 2017-2018 season at the Bastrop Opera House. It considers how our lives could be revolutionized if we only changed how we interacted to people.
